Alan Carr: Chatty Man is a British
chat show hosted by
Alan Carr on
Channel 4 that began in 2009. The sixteenth and final series premiered on 3 March 2016.

Christmas special (2016)
It was announced on 9 October 2016 that Chatty Man had been cancelled after Series 16 due to low ratings. It was then confirmed that there would be a Christmas Day special.
